Tahoe Glass Company is a local business in Tahoe Vista, CA that specializes in the creation and installation of custom glass products.
With a focus on quality craftsmanship and personalized service, they cater to residential and commercial clients seeking unique glass solutions for their spaces.
Generated from their business information